First the French and now the Spanish intend to wreck the Brits holidays in August.

The date for the strike has not yet been set but it is expected to start on August 18.

In February this year the government slashed controllers salaries by around 40 per cent – cutting the average wage from £290,000-a-year to £167,000 – after it was revealed some enjoyed pay of up to £800,000-a-year.

In Britain the same workers earn a basic salary of between £60,000 and £90,000-a-year, according to National Air Traffic Services.
